The Navarro County inmate roster is a publicly accessible list of individuals who have been arrested and are currently being detained within Navarro County, Texas. This roster provides important information regarding the status of each inmate, including their name, booking number, date of arrest, charges, and bail amount.
Maintaining an inmate roster is an essential function of any county jail or detention center. The Navarro County Sheriff’s Office is responsible for updating and maintaining the inmate roster for the county’s detention center. The roster is updated regularly to ensure that it is accurate and up-to-date.
The Navarro County inmate roster can be accessed online through the Navarro County Sheriff’s Office website. This makes it easy for anyone to view the list of inmates, their status, and other important information. It is important to note that the information provided in the roster is public information, and it can be accessed by anyone.
